More than 1,000 patients a month have been coming to Prince William Hospital's new free-standing emergency room, open less than a year, located in a corner of a medical office building in Manassas, Va.
 
Emergency rooms tend to be more overcrowded and have longer wait times in areas where there are fewer primary-care doctors. More than 200 satellite emergency rooms are open nationwide, some intended to relieve congestion, others to claim a spot in
a growing community for the parent hospital.
